    Axles for rail transit primarily include metro axles, light rail axles, and low-floor tram axles (including integrated forged axle bridges). These axles are essential for ensuring the reliable operation of various rail transit vehicles under high load conditions. The axle diameters range from Φ90mm to Φ280mm, with lengths varying between 1600mm and 2650mm. Common materials include LZW, AAR F, EA1N, JZ45, 42CrMo, and EA4T.
